WILBURN v. STATE

27895.

230 Ga. 675 (1973)

198 S.E.2d 857

WILBURN v. THE STATE.

Supreme Court of Georgia.

Decided May 31, 1973.

Rehearing Denied June 21, 1973.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Harrison & Garner, G. Hughel Harrison, for appellant.

W. Bryant Huff, District Attorney, Gary Davis, Dawson Jackson, Arthur K. Bolton, Attorney General, Courtney Wilder Stanton, Assistant Attorney General, B. Dean Grindle, Jr., Deputy Assistant Attorney General, for appellee.


UNDERCOFLER, Justice.

Herman Franklin Wilburn was indicted and convicted of the murder of Bonnie Skinner (also known as Mrs. Herman Franklin Wilburn) by shooting her with a pistol. He was sentenced to life imprisonment.
